Those parade pictures are taken from the Main Street RailRoad Station platform. It makes for an interesting angle, but honestly I think that you lose the awe of the floats looking down on them. Next time I'll try to shoot it from below. I'd really like the pics to show how pretty the parade can be with the lights turned on. My flash kinda' washed out the floats' lights.
